WordPress 上传附件提示“父目录是否可以被服务器写入?”解决办法

昨天有空闲,对一个许久没有打理过的网站更新了一篇文章,但在上传附件时,提示错误:无法创建目录 uploads/2024/11。它的父目录是否可以被服务器写入?

尝试了几次都不行,就登录服务器查看目录写入权限。发现 /wp-content/ uploads/ 的权限是755,和其他网站的文件夹权限是一致的。

我又手动创建了 2024/11/ 文件夹,转到 WordPress 上传附件,错误提示依旧。看来不是文件夹权限的问题。

度娘了一下,发现这个问题挺常见的:WordPress 用户在后台上传附件提示“上级目录没有写权限”的情况一般发生在网站迁移到新站以后。

我想起来,的确是在4个月前把网站从阿里云转到了腾讯云来,后来一直没有更新过文章,所以到今天才暴露这个问题。

按网友的经验,解决这个问题,首先确保以上提示中的 网站目录 uploads/是存在,并且访问权限是可以写入的,如果不是请按以下方法依次处理:

1,检查主机目录中 /wp-content/ 下文件夹是否有 uploads 文件夹,如果没有,建立一个名字为 uploads 的文件夹,设置权限为755;

2,登录 WordPress 网站后台,打开【设置 — 媒体】, 查看默认上传路径设置,保证默认上传路径为 “ wp-content/ uploads”。

我的情况是第1点问题不存在,第2点默认上传路径和当前的不一致,直接改为缺省值 “ wp-content/ uploads”,问题解决。

回顾整个过程,因为我换了空间,媒体上传路径还是原来的路径设置,所以找不到父目录了。只需要在后台--设置--多媒体--那个路径那里填写正确路径即可。


历史上的今天:

相关推荐

如何禁用 WordPress 在线安装、升级和编辑功能

之前因为访问时经常会跳转至无关网站,我把网站的 WordPress 程序在线安装、升级和编辑功能给禁用了。但考虑到安全问题,我今天解除此禁用,把网站程序更新升级到 WordPress 6.8.2 最新版本。 要禁用 WordPress 的在线安装、升级和编辑功能,可通过修改 wp-config.php 文件来实现。 1、禁止安装、升级、编辑主题和插件 ...

WordPress 建议更新 PHP 版本,推荐 8.3 或更高版本

将网站 WordPress 程序更新到 6.8.1 版本后,后台弹出了“建议更新 PHP 版本”对话框,提示:您的站点正在运行过时版本的 PHP(8.0.26),其无法接收安全更新,且应当被升级。 PHP 是用过搭建 WordPress 的编程语言之一,主机运营商一般已经设置了可使用于站点的 PHP 版本。平时我们都知道保持 WordPress、主题和插件处 ...

如何实现 WordPress 网站页面内容的分页显示?

我的 WordPress 网站中有个“阅读记录”页面,按年份记录了自己一年中阅读过的图书目录。五年下来,文章的内容比较多,页面拉得很长,浏览起来不太方便。所以我想让页面内容按年份分页显示,一年一个分页,通过导航条切换,方便地浏览。 WordPress 编辑器中有“分页符”按钮,在需要分页的地方点击此按钮,就会加入 < ...

WordPress 网站如何开启维护模式?

网站因更新或维护等原因,会导致访问出错的情况,这时我们可能需要临时关闭网站。如果你的网站是用 WordPress 程序搭建的,则你可通过以下方法开启网站维护模式,给出一个维护提示的页面,以确保用户体验不受影响,同时也能够保护你的数据安全。 一、使用主题功能 许多 WordPress 主题都内置了“维护模式”的选项,我们 ...

暂无评论

发表评论

您的电子邮件地址不会被公开,必填项已用*标注。